What are the Constitutional Safeguards and Legal Frameworks for Freedom of the Press in India?
The freedom of the press in India, implicit under Article 19(1)(a) of the Constitution, is vital for democracy. While it empowers open dialogue, it is subject to reasonable restrictions under Article 19(2) to ensure public order, security, and individual rights.

How Has Media Law Evolved in India: A Historical and Legal Journey?
Media law in India governs the regulation of media activities, balancing freedom of expression with necessary restrictions. Its evolution spans from ancient India to the colonial era, culminating in post-independence legislation ensuring responsible media practices.
